Earlier this summer, first-time novelist Edan Lepucki caught a lucky break. Just as her debut bookCalifornia was due to come out, her publisher and Amazon got into a pricing dispute that caught the eye of Stephen Colbert. In an attempt to help out authors caught in the crossfire, Colbert chose Lepucki’s book as a title to champion. In his show’s appeal, he asked viewers to buy the book in droves—from anywhere but Amazon.
Now we can appreciate the novel itself, and not the furor around it.
